  Finding Articles
best resource Engineering Village 2 -- ELECTRONIC
The combined Compendex®, Ei Backfile & Inspec® databases allow for searching on a broad range of topics within the scientific, applied science, technical and engineering disciplines. It also covers engineering websites, CRC Handbooks, patents, and industry standards.  This is by far the best place to search for journal articles relating to mechanical engineering.

International Encyclopedia Of Heat And Mass Transfer
TJ260.I579 1997, Hagerty Reference, 1st floor
Comprehensive reference for those needing information on heat and mass transfer. It covers a wide range of topics including primary processes, associated thermodynamics and fluid physical properties, and basic equations and their methods of solution. Details of the plant and equipment associated with heat and mass transfer processes are also covered.
Encyclopedia Of Fluid Mechanics
TA357.E53 1986, Hagerty Reference, 1st floor
A comprehensive treatise-type encyclopedia. (It is arranged systematically.) The intent of this encyclopedia is to provide an integrated presentation of the extensive and widely scattered information relating to all types of flow phenomena of practical interest.
